Woolly-style Heath (Epacris Lanuginosa) is a perennial shrub in the Ericaceae family with moderate care difficulty. It requires moderate watering and full sun or partial shade light in USDA hardiness zones 8-10. This plant is safe for cats and dogs.
Epacris lanuginosa is a slender, erect shrub with woolly stems and small, lance-shaped leaves, endemic to south-eastern Australia.
